Position

White: king g1; queen h5; rooks a1/e1; bishop d2; knight c3; pawns a2/b2/c2/e6/g3/h2. Black: king h7; queen g8; rooks a8/g6; bishops a6/b4; knight d7; pawns a7/c5/d5/f5/h6. Black is ahead by 2 points of material. White to move.

Solution (4 moves)

  1. Opponent setup: d4 — pawn d5→d4. Now White to move.
  2. Best move: exd7 — pawn e6→d7, captures knight. Opponent replies Rxg3+ (rook g6→g3, captures pawn, gives check).
  3. Best move: hxg3 — pawn h2→g3, captures rook. Opponent replies Qxg3+ (queen g8→g3, captures pawn, gives check).
  4. Best move: Kh1 — king g1→h1. Opponent replies Bb7+ (bishop a6→b7, gives check).
  5. Best move: Ne4 — knight c3→e4.

Tactical themes

advanced pawn, advantage, hanging piece, middlegame, very long. The key move exd7 wins material.
